Some suggestions from me: not sure what your android experience is so some of these may seem n00bish, sorry!

If you're ever going to use custom roms or root the device, get the bootloader unlocked ASAP as it requires a wipe of your phone for security. Wiping after setting up can be no fun.

Get your music matched/uploaded to Google Music if you haven't.
Setup chrome sync if you're a chrome user.

Remember you can install apps from any web browser to your nexus from http://play.google.com

Some quick suggestions:

Press - best RSS reader I've used. Currently syncs with Google Reader but an alternative has been promised with the closure of Google Reader in July.
Pocket (formerly read it later)
Box (free 50gb storage offer may be still on from LG phones, I got it back with my Neuxs)
Google Drive (includes google docs).
Plex (if you want to stream audio/video/music to your Nexus)
Falcon Pro for Twitter.
SwiftKey keyboard. Better than anything I've used. There is a free trial on the play store.

Amazon AppStore via the amazon website for the free app every day.

Hope some of those are ok. Don't forget the 15 min refund window on paid android apps.
